Beacon API ❞ 什么是 Resize Observer API Resize Observer API[1] 可以帮助我们监听元素尺寸的变化,并在尺寸变化时执行一些操作。...如何使用 Resize Observer API 使用 Resize Observer API 非常简单。接下来我会通过 3 个使用示例带大家熟悉 Resize Observer API。...Resize Observer API 的实际应用 Resize Observer API 可以在很多实际场景中使用。...Resize Observer API 的兼容性 Resize Observer API 是一个比较新的 Web API,目前仅在现代浏览器中得到支持。...Observer API: https://developer.mozilla.org/en-US/docs/Web/API/Resize_Observer_API [2] react-resize-observer
鼠标进入(进入子元素不触发) mouseleave() 鼠标离开(离开子元素不触发) hover() 同时为mouseenter和mouseleave事件指定处理函数 ready() DOM加载完成 resize...() 浏览器窗口的大小发生改变 scroll() 滚动条的位置发生变化 submit() 用户递交表单 resize() 浏览器窗口的大小发生改变 其实大部分resize()方法是用于响应式布局调整屏幕大小的时候进行触发处理的...这里就不写那么复杂的事情,只写一下当浏览器窗口变化的时候,触发resize()事件看看。...html> jquery.../jquery-3.3.1.min.js"> $(function(){
项目中有两份代码,一份是Main Site,一份是Mobile Site.Main Site里面主页使用到jQuery Tools Scrollable功能,让多张图片循环显示。...一个基本scrollable实现代码可以参考jQuery Tools的官方文档。...所以需要在页面load之后就进行resize操作。基本解决办法是在调用scrollable()方法之前就进行图片的resize操作。...-- jQuery Library + UI Tools --> <!...$("#scrollable").css("height", ModuleHeight); } } $(window).resize
即便当年漫山红遍的JQuery(让开发者write less, do more,So Perfect!!)如今也有被替代的大势。...但JS原生API写法依旧;并且有时候只不过小写一个Demo,或者产品中只有少量的前端效果或DOM操作,就去花时间&空间引入jQuery,或者React?不免有取宰牛之刀以杀鸡之嫌。...在jQuery的温柔乡里,是否还能记得原生她javascript原生?如果仅为使用个选择器($)或者类似的东西,是否真的有必要加载jQuery?故此了解下JS常用原生写法还是蛮有必要的。...[update-2015-12-07]有看到抛弃jQuery,拥抱原生JavaScript一文中提到,jQuery 代表着传统的以 DOM 为中心的开发模式,但现在复杂页面开发流行的是以 React 为代表的以数据...Show me the code.直接看代码;以下是jQuery和JavaScript实现相同操作的等价代码: 选择元素 // jQuery var els = $('.el'); //===
下载地址: http://files.cnblogs.com/purediy/jquery-easyui-1.3.2.rar 兄弟版本: jQuery EasyUI 1.3.4 离线API、Demo jQuery...EasyUI 1.3.0 Demo合集、离线API、动态换肤 jQuery EasyUI 1.2.6 源码、demo合集、离线api、个性化的layout布局 没什么可说的,仅为了方便查看,把Demo...做成了合集,API都做成了离线版本,和官网完全一致。...jQuery EasyUI 1.3.2 Demo ? jQuery EasyUI 1.3.2 API ?
/jquery.easyui.min.js"> function resize(){ $('#w').window({ title: 'yewen2',...()">resize open Ok resize getSelected <a href="#" onclick="getSelections
/js/jquery.js" type="text/javascript"> jQuery.validator.format("请输入 一个长度介于 {0} 和 {1} 之间的字符串"), range: jQuery.validator.format("请输入一个介于 {0}...和 {1} 之间的值"), max: jQuery.validator.format("请输入一个最大为{0} 的值"), min: jQuery.validator.format("请输入一个最小为.../js/jquery.js" type="text/javascript"> API 名称 返回类型 描述 validate(options) 返回:Validator 验证所选的FORM valid() 返回:
现在MVVM框架逐渐占据了主要市场,很多老项目也逐渐的从jQuery转向了MVVM架构!JQuery还有必要学吗? 我的答案是jQuery必须学!...JavaScript是基础,JQuery能让DOM操作更方便,哪怕用vue react当操作dom的时候 还是离不开的,只是说可以不用学的那么深。 下面就整理一下我之前工作中用到的一些API jquery-3.5.1.min.js"> .clr_red { background-color: red;...('p'); function fun_is_element(elementName) { return $("#p_text").is(elementName); } 4、jquery
为了方便自己测试rest api,所以做了一个动态参数的页面。大家有需要的话,就各取所需吧。 API.../script/jquery-1.5.2.min.js"> jquery.autocomplete.min.js"> api/"+$("#action").val(); alert(action) var formData = new Object();
学习jQuery Mobile也有一段时间了,越来越上手了,也越来越喜欢他了。我根本就没有理由拒绝他的好。这里我有分享一下我对它的配置项的使用说明一下。...因为 jQuery Mobile 会记录 location hash , //这有可能会为网站带来 cross-site scripting (XSS) 攻击,因此该选项默认为 false 。...Mobile //增强(jQuery Mobile 元素增强指的是 jQuery Mobile 对网页基本元素在样式上的丰富、交互上的增强以及相应的 HTML 结构改造)。...这样开发者可以创建属于自己的命名空间,避免与 jQuery Mobile 原有的属性发生冲突, 便于制作自定义主题。...jQuery Mobile 建议在关闭 Ajax 导航和大量使用外部链接的情况下关闭这个特性。
正文-JavaScript-客户端API & jQuery JavaScript 是用来丰富网站的内容的,让网站支持各种交互行为功能等等。...以上基本的语法了解后,至少就知道如何声明变量、函数、对象,如何使用了,这就足够了,那么接下去就是熟悉下客户端 API,也可以说是浏览器按照标准提供的各 API 的使用。...所以,下面会分别介绍 W3C 规范的标准 API 和 jQuery 的使用: DOM API document document 是内置的全局变量,在 JavaScript 可以直接通过该关键字使用,使用时会获取到当前...jQuery 为什么使用 jQuery 类似于 JVM 隐藏了不同操作系统之间的差异,让开发能够更专注于功能的实现,而不必花费过多时间适配不同操作系统。...jQuery 隐藏了不同浏览器之间的差异,减少开发者花费在适配不同浏览器之间的精力。
FileName: "3.bpm", Extension: ".bpm", FileType: 2 }); $.ajax({ url: "/api...AppendFiles(List files) { //上传文件处理 } 结果,后台中接收到的files为空 原因:jQuery...的怪癖 解决: .ajax({ url: "/api/file/uploadservice", type...} }); 参考文献: http://kwilson.me.uk/blog/post-an-array-of-objects-to-webapi-using-jquery
常用插件 插件:jquery不可能包含所有的功能,我们可以通过插件扩展jquery的功能。 jQuery有着丰富的插件,使用这些插件能给jQuery提供一些额外的功能。...官方API:http://api.jqueryui.com/category/all/ 其他教程:jQueryUI教程 基本使用: 2. 1. 引入jQueryUI的样式文件 2....border-top-left-radius: 5px; border-top-right-radius: 5px; cursor: move; } .resize-item...head> 可拖动、排序、变形的新闻模块 resize-item...drag-bar" }); $(".sort-item").sortable({ opacity:0.3 }); $(".resize-item
$.ajax({ type: "post", url: "http://localhost:7247/api
窗口的 resize 事件,列表的 scroll 事件,输入框 input 事件,触发频繁很高,都可以用防抖来优化。...API: _.debounce(func, [wait=0], [options=]) 参数说明: func (Function): 要防抖动的函数。...例子: jQuery(window).on( 'resize', _.debounce(calculateLayout, 150) ) 3 节流 节流用来控制事件发生的频率。...例子: const throttled = _.throttle( renewToken, 300000, { 'trailing': false } ); jQuery(element)....API: _.compact(array) 例子: _.compact([0, 1, false, 2, '', 3]); // => [1, 2, 3] 7 生成全局唯一ID API: _.uniqueId
看了dudu的《HttpClient + ASP.NET Web API, WCF之外的另一个选择》一文,想起多很久之前体现ASP.NET Web API而创建的一个Demo。...这是一个只涉及到简单CRUD操作的Web应用,业务逻辑以Web API的形式定义并以服务的形式发布出来,前台通过jQuery处理用户交互并调用后台服务。...[源代码从这里下载] 目录 一、一个简单的基于CRUD 二、通过ASP.NET Web API提供服务 三、通过JQuery消费服务 一、一个简单的基于CRUD...三、通过JQuery消费服务 我们通过ASP.NET MVC来构建Web应用,默认的HomeController定义如下,默认的Index操作仅仅是将默认的View呈现出来而已。...ActionResult Index() 4: { 5: return View(); 6: } 7: } View中对用户操作的相应和对后台服务的调用都通过JQuery
JsonpMediaTypeFormatter()); $('#getjson').bind('click', function () { $.getJSON("http://192.168.103.135:8080/api
webqq 中 自适应宽度的JS代码 jquery/1.2.6/jquery.min.js">api.js">...width: 1026,height: $(window).height()}) }; }); }catch(e){ } $(window).resize
user-scalable=no"/> Simple Map api...background: #7EABCD; } api.../library/3.9/3.9/init.js"> jquery-1.8.3.js"> ...); $("#map").css("width",($(window).width()-200)+"px"); map.resize...《"){//展开状态 $("#map").css("width",($(window).width()-200)+"px"); map.resize
免费接口一天只能用300次,所以在不用的时候请关闭,不然就会和帅小伙一样全是undefind了 $.ajax({ type: "get", url: "https://tianqiapi.com/api...response.tem2 + "℃ - " + response.tem1 + "℃"; } }); 这样就可以返回当前ip地址下的天气情况,处理一下渲染即可,由于帅小伙比较懒,发现有文件夹里有 jQuery...的包就直接用jq了 对于这样单纯使用 jQuery 中 Ajax 的方式还是不推荐的,毕竟 jQuery 的体积太大了 3....', function () { myChart.resize() }) })(); 4....", function () { myChart.resize(); }); })(); 5.